A heated tile for underneath your cat’s bed can provide real comfort. Place a tile made of terra cotta or a similar material in an oven heated to 200 degrees for around 15 to 20 minutes. Wrap the tile inside an unneeded towel and place it under your kitty’s favorite resting spot. Change it out every few hours if you feel the need.

Taking your cat to the vet is part of being a responsible pet owner. Most vets recommend yearly check-ups. If the animal requires certain vaccinations, more visits are necessary. Cats should visit the vet right away if they are having any issues.

Cats spend lots of time grooming themselves. If the cat has longer hair, it can be the cause of hairballs. To fix this problem, you can try buying a new food. There are foods that are made to reduce the frequency of hairballs. It’s a smart move for your cat and your sanity.

You will often find ways to save money on medication for your cat on the Internet instead of getting it from your vet. There are some times when this isn’t a good idea, like when you’re dealing with a pet related emergency. But, if you’re having to buy pet medication regularly, you will be able to save up to half the price if you buy online.

Speak with other cat owners about any issues you may be having. You can solve most problems by yourself, but you might benefit from the experience of others. There are a number of message boards for cat owners on the Internet, or you can go to your vet with problems.

If your cat relieves itself away from its litter box, do not spring into action with punishment. Check out the box instead and see if it has been neglected; this is often a cause of accidents. It isn’t fair to punish a cat for wanting a clean area to do its business, and you don’t want to make the cat wary of you.

You eat quality food, and if you want your cat to stick around a long time, they need quality food, too. Check out the list of ingredients of any food you are considering buying. Ensure that an animal protein source, including fish, chicken, or beef, is the main ingredient. Try to avoid foods that consist of corn, or other non-protein elements. Because cats are carnivores, their diet need only consist of a good source of protein.

Drinking Fountain

Purchase a drinking fountain for your cat. A cat will always drink from running water if possible. Streaming water is much easier for your cat to take in. Cats will even drink from the tap if they can! Installing a drinking fountain for your cat is a more eco-friendly way to provide it with some running water.
